He also points out that acording to the current version of PracticeOnNames R's abbreviated name in the account would be acceptable but deprecated. . 2011-09-30 (A): Sent reminder to R, setting deadline of 2011-10-14 for reply. . 2011-10-17 (A): Since there is no answer by R support shall provide alternate mail addresses of the account. . 2011-10-17 Support reports: no alternate mail addresses exist. . 2014-05-11 (CM): asks A about progress in this case . 2014-05-15 (A): Send final reminder to R, announcing that the account will be locked and all certificates revoked if no answer is received till 2014-05-29 . 2015-03-30 (A): Informed all parties about given ruling == Discovery (Private Part) == * Link to Arbitration case [[Arbitrations/priv/a20101009.1|a20101009.1 (Private Part)]] <> == Discovery == * Current version of PracticeOnNames allows the name combination, but depreceates it. == Ruling == Since the Respondent does not reply to mail messages this is a violation of [[https://www.cacert.org/policy/CAcertCommunityAgreement.html|CCA]] 2.5.2 and/or 2.3.4. The Respondent cannot be regarded as "bound into Arbitration" as required by the [[https://www.cacert.org/policy/AssurancePolicy.html#s1.1|Assurance Statement 1.1.4]], therefor the account shall be locked and all existing certificates shall be revoked. The Respondent may file a dispute to unlock his account, which will start a normal Arbitration Case. If the Respondent answers within one week of this ruling, this case will be continued instead.
